Full Job Description
Requisition ID: 259937

Purpose of Job:

The primary mandate of this role is to lead, manage, and continuously evolve the Central Planning Group-a national team of financial planning professionals with varying levels of expertise-responsible for providing financial planning software support to Advisors and Planners across Scotia Wealth Management, Scotia Financial Planning, MD Management, and the Retail Bank.

Major Accountabilities:

Lead the Central Planning Group and support its continuing evolution by focusing on operational excellence, service quality, and advisor experience.
• Coaching to ensure the delivery of strong service levels related to telephone and email support for financial planning questions and engagements from basic to complex.
• Championing a customer focused culture to deepen client relationships and build broader Bank relationships.
• Continually enhancing the knowledge of the Central Planning Group by providing technical sessions on new and innovative planning strategies.
• Support advisor education through case consultations, best practice sharing, tools, and internal knowledge resources
• Design, implement, and continuously improve the financial planning help desk service model, including intake, prioritization, SLAs, escalation protocols, and turnaround standards
• Act as the primary point of accountability for resolving operational or service delivery issues impacting the advisor experience.
• Collect and synthesize advisor feedback to continuously improve the help desk value proposition

Stakeholder Partnership Management;
• Act as a strategic partner to Regional Directors, Senior Managers, and Product and Platform teams to align planning solutions with business priorities.
• Influence decisions across the enterprise by providing data driven insights and recommendations related to planning effectiveness, advisor capacity, and client outcomes.

Promote awareness of the Central Planning Group and Total Wealth Planning, by:
• Build awareness and adoption of the Central Planning Group (CPG) and Client Solutions through strategic internal communications and partnerships.
• Partner with regional leadership to promote the CPG planning experience, emphasizing planning oversight, timely delivery, and opportunity management.
• Collaborate with Marketing and key internal stakeholders to ensure Total Wealth Planning is effectively positioned within enterprise initiatives.
• Develop and refine internal content and collateral (articles, newsletters, presentations, and resources) to support advisor engagement and new initiatives.
• Act as a subject matter expert on planning-related projects led by Total Wealth Planning or other business partners, as required.

Education & Experience - Enhancements
• Demonstrated experience leading large scale strategic initiatives or enterprise projects within Wealth Management or Financial Services.
• Experience translating strategy into execution, including operating model change, service model design, or technology enablement.
• Strong executive communication skills, including the ability to present recommendations and progress updates to senior leadership.

Strategic Initiatives & Enterprise Project Leadership
• Own and lead priority strategic initiatives on behalf of the Total Wealth Planning leadership team, including operating model evolution, capacity optimization, and planning enablement programs.
• Translate TWP strategy into clearly defined initiatives, project plans, milestones, and success metrics.
• Lead cross functional project teams including Technology, Operations, Compliance, Marketing, and Regional Wealth partners.
• Measure and communicate initiative outcomes, business impact, risks, and interdependencies to senior leadership.

Education/Work Experience/Designations
Required:
• University degree
• Accredited financial planning designation (CFP, or Pl.Fin -IPF applicable for Quebec)
• Continuing education through wealth management industry courses
• Over 5 years of experience as a practicing financial planner in the High Net Worth space
• Experience managing a large national team

Desirables:
• Life Insurance license
• Comprehensive technical and behavioural understanding and execution of the financial planning process including investments, asset protection, retirement, estate planning, cash management, taxation issues and risk management to clients
• Working knowledge of financial planning software; Conquest Planning
• Knowledge of data gathering, reporting and analysis for management reporting
• Working knowledge of the Wealth Management business line including the value proposition, the products and services it provides to high-net-worth clients, and the manner in which they are delivered

About Scotiabank

Scotiabankers are committed to helping individuals, companies, and communities to thrive in a changing world. From personal and business banking, brokerage, and insurance, to private wealth, and the most sophisticated commercial, corporate and institutional services, they serve the diverse needs of some 21 million customers in more than 55 countries. Founded in 1832 in Halifax, Nova Scotia, their growth has always been fuelled by the success of their customers and their longevity secured by an unshakable commitment to carefully and expertly managing risk and capital. That focus on doing what's right for customers—short- andlong-term—has made us a global financial services leader. Headquartered in Canada, they are over 86, 000 Scotiabankers strong. Each of us are committed to being the best at understanding their customers' needs and all of us working together to deliver practical advice and relevant solutions that help their customers become financially better off.
